Rates & Terms
Borrowers in Westphalia with credit scores above 740 and LTVs below 70% can qualify for the most competitive home equity rates.
Rates in MD are influenced by the prime rate, your credit score, combined LTV, and whether the property is your primary residence.
Requirements in Westphalia
Lenders in Westphalia verify income, employment, and assets; self-employed borrowers may need additional documentation.
A current appraisal, title search, and proof of homeowner's insurance are required to close a home equity loan in MD.

Borrowing Tips for Westphalia
- Consider a cash-out refinance instead if current mortgage rates are lower than your existing rate.
- Compare at least three lenders; home equity loan rates and fees vary significantly between banks and credit unions.
- Understand the risk: defaulting on a home equity loan can lead to foreclosure on your primary residence.
